Follow the diet

Breakfast is the main meal of the day and in no case should be missing. Start your stomach 30 minutes before breakfast by drinking a glass of warm water. The recommended daily intake of water is 30 ml per 1 kg of body weight, and it is better to drink warm water. There should be at least 3 and no more than 5 meals per day. Get up from the table with a slight feeling of hunger - this way you can avoid overeating.

Eat more fiber

It is found in whole grains, raw vegetables, and fruits. Fiber is food for beneficial intestinal bacteria, in addition, it removes toxins from our body. This is an integral component of our diet so that our digestive tract works in a balanced way.

Eat more healthy fats

Add quality fats to your diet in the form of raw oils in salads and porridge.
It is the fats in food that stimulate the gallbladder, which ensures a stable bile flow. This is important for the health of the entire gastrointestinal tract and the regular act of defecation. Thanks to fats, vitamins such as A, E, D, K are absorbed. They are responsible for our energy balance, skin turgor, and are part of the protective shell of each cell.

Reduce the amount of sugar

The use of excessive amounts of refined sugar affects the work of all systems of our body, primarily hormonal, digestive and cardiovascular.
Refined foods stimulate the growth of pathogenic microflora. By reducing the amount of sweets, you will remove the additional burden on the immune system. Find more about How to Improve Immunity in our blog.

Lead an active lifestyle

Walk at least 8 thousand steps per day, if possible, and add sports 3 times a week. Physical activity improves intestinal motility and stimulates digestion.
